Interact with Alchemy's Web3 APIs for blockchain data, NFTs, tokens, transfers, and webhooks across 80+ chains.
74
Quality
63%
Does it follow best practices?
Impact
98%
1.04xAverage score across 3 eval scenarios
Advisory
Suggest reviewing before use
Optimize this skill with Tessl
npx tessl skill review --optimize ./data/skills-md/0xgizmolab/alchemy-web3-skill/alchemy-web3/SKILL.mdAlchemy SDK integration
alchemy-sdk package
100%
100%
Correct SDK import
100%
100%
API key from environment
100%
100%
Network constant used
100%
100%
getNftsForOwner method
100%
100%
getTokenBalances method
100%
100%
getAssetTransfers method
100%
100%
Transfer category param
100%
100%
ownedNfts result field
100%
100%
Report env var documented
100%
100%
Without context: $0.3691 · 1m 25s · 19 turns · 26 in / 5,449 out tokens
With context: $0.6144 · 2m 7s · 25 turns · 32 in / 6,971 out tokens
JSON-RPC direct API transfers
Correct API base URL
100%
100%
API key in URL path
100%
100%
API key from environment
100%
100%
alchemy_getAssetTransfers method
100%
100%
fromBlock and toBlock params
100%
100%
Comprehensive categories
100%
100%
Both directions queried
100%
100%
maxCount parameter
100%
0%
429 error handling
100%
100%
401 error handling
100%
100%
JSON-RPC structure
100%
100%
Without context: $0.2658 · 1m 12s · 16 turns · 22 in / 4,265 out tokens
With context: $0.3230 · 59s · 16 turns · 21 in / 3,652 out tokens
Multi-chain token and NFT queries
eth-mainnet prefix
100%
100%
polygon-mainnet prefix
100%
100%
arb-mainnet prefix
100%
100%
base-mainnet prefix
100%
100%
alchemy_getTokenBalances method
100%
100%
NFT API URL format
0%
100%
getNFTsForOwner endpoint
0%
100%
alchemy_getTokenMetadata method
100%
100%
API key from environment
100%
100%
API key in URL path
100%
100%
All four chains queried
100%
100%
Without context: $0.2171 · 1m · 13 turns · 17 in / 4,333 out tokens
With context: $0.3463 · 1m 11s · 15 turns · 271 in / 4,637 out tokens
5342bca
Table of Contents
If you maintain this skill, you can claim it as your own. Once claimed, you can manage eval scenarios, bundle related skills, attach documentation or rules, and ensure cross-agent compatibility.